    Sujet

    CETP involved in the transfer of insoluble cholesteryl esters in the reverse transport of cholesterol. Defects in CETP are a cause of hyperalphalipoproteinemia. Cholesteryl ester transfer protein (CETP) transfers cholesteryl esters between lipoproteins. CETP may effect susceptibility to atherosclerosis.
